olgerd83 Posted May 9, 2021 Author Share Posted May 9, 2021 propeller is ready, to paint it I used a Radome as base colour, added masks and covered with Red brown, after removing masks used oil paint to have a wooden effect on the lighter layer. Finally propeller was covered with Future Martinnfb, Gazzas, MikeMaben and 3 others 6 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
olgerd83 Posted May 9, 2021 Author Share Posted May 9, 2021 - for machine gun cowls I used old Fotocut PE kit - made a preshading for bottom sides - bottom sides were painted with light blue, covered with Future and decals were applied. Also I used Gaspatch resin anchor points and turnbuckles, I wish I knew that they are very fragile. I had to buy the metal ones instead. I spent more than a week for simple rigging...
